看板 Soft_Job 關於我們 聯絡資訊
一個18歲剛學寫program的人,學domain knowledge有意義嗎 原PO,應該是完全缺乏一個programmer的基礎吧 沒有這些基礎,學會domain knowledge也是沒意義的 以前看過有人列出programmer應有的基礎知識,個人也向這個方向學習中 1.認識各種algorithm和data structure 2.OOP,IoC等concept,重要是以aggregation為主的OOP 3.對OS的概念,virtual memory, scheduling,pipeline 等 3.database concept,normalization 4.TCP/IP,NS,HTTP,SOCKET,SSL等WEB PROTOCOL原理 5.basic concept of image processing 6.xml standard和使用 7.design pattern 8.加密原理,one way hash, public private key等 9.明白什麼是testability,scalability 10.AI,computer graphic,data mining, full text search的原理 18歲不是學domain 的時候,還是留待工作才學吧 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 219.78.102.31
gmoz:但是鬼島沒有programmer應有的薪水那種標準 (淚 05/31 12:55
andymai:突然覺得這串文有點像是爸媽為了小孩的將來在鋪路~但是... 05/31 12:58
andymai:會自我學習的小孩往往不會照著爸媽的期待走... XD 05/31 12:59
ianlin45:哪能工作才學啊 05/31 14:24
ianlin45:大學四年是最好學習的時間 05/31 14:25
ianlin45:原po說他升學考試很差 如果是英文和數學很差就要擔心了 05/31 14:26
AzureCoder:domain會隨工作環境改變,可是基礎是必要的 05/31 14:27
ianlin45:高中數學沒學好 怎麼學大學數學 大學沒學好 工作才學哪 05/31 14:29
ianlin45:學得會啊 05/31 14:29
ianlin45:coding就還好 工作才學也可以 05/31 14:30
KanoLoa:...樓上你這樣的意思就好像coding比高中數學還簡單 05/31 14:45
AzureCoder:近十年的program開始shift到high level,感覺數學的重要 05/31 14:47
AzureCoder:性沒以前高,反而oop比較重要,所以英語才是最大的敵人 05/31 14:47
AzureCoder:呀 05/31 14:47
asleisureto:數學其實不重要 05/31 14:51
asleisureto:英文的話是學尖端技術和離開鬼島的門票 05/31 14:52
asleisureto:記得原原PO有提他會找原文技術文章來看 光這股熱忱就 05/31 14:52
asleisureto:能打死九成資工生了 05/31 14:53
AzureCoder:看原本書是必需的,有些書根本找不到好的中文代替品 05/31 15:05
ianlin45:有的人寫一輩子都不用數學沒錯 但一旦需要用到 就一翻兩 05/31 15:12
ianlin45:瞪眼 05/31 15:12
ianlin45:coding比大學數學簡單啊 05/31 15:18
windycity:這些不就是大學資工在上的東西...... 05/31 16:07
pttsomeone:給樓上 大學是教當時的東西 可是很多東西都會再改良 05/31 17:05
TonyQ:大學資工字面上的東西是都有教到沒錯啦,但內涵有沒有教到就 05/31 17:15
TonyQ:另一回事了。 05/31 17:16
shemale:我也曾覺得數學不重要,若有一天我被fire,一定是因為數學 05/31 18:44
shemale:我們這裡,數學不好很難活下去,老實說,我沒打握能撐幾年 05/31 18:45
windycity:上面列的東西大部分都十幾年沒變了吧,我當初念大學課本 05/31 21:26
windycity:幾乎都還可以用啊 XD 05/31 21:26
PSptt:趨勢到底有沒有賺錢.. 05/31 21:59
ldkrsi:所謂的英文好是指可以和外國人溝通 還是看得懂外國論壇上的 05/31 22:10
ldkrsi:討論和教學??  好奇 05/31 22:10
ldkrsi:我覺得後者應該就夠用了 但很多工作都要求前者 05/31 22:12
Mewra:有研究動機後再去學習tools不是很棒的流程嗎?一開始無目的 05/31 23:33
Mewra:的去學習程式語言多乏味~ 05/31 23:33
Mewra:原PO列的這些技能隨便挑幾樣花時間研究之後都能在業界掛個 05/31 23:43
Mewra:engineer的抬頭,然後也過的不錯,只是是要以什麼樣的心態或動 05/31 23:43
Mewra:機去挑選要學習的技能..如何運用自己的技能達成自己設定的目 05/31 23:48
Mewra:標 05/31 23:49
luciferii:這篇列出的11項裏就有一半以上不是純coding的東西啊 06/01 10:54
luciferii:結論怎會是18歲不要學? 06/01 10:54